I had a GW690III (90mm lens) at one point many years ago. It was an odd sort of machine - big and rather clunky but produced some fantastic photos. No light meter built-in so you have to use a separate one or another camera, and so fully manual. Also rather lighter than you'd expect from such a big camera so not a burden to carry around like your RB67 must be :)

Fuji 690? I borrowed one for about a year and it was great.

There were basically 3 marks and as far as I can tell and from Googleing it was only cosmetic changes done between the MkI to MkIII.

All are mechanical, with fixed lens and they come in two flavors the Fuji G690 and Fuji GSW690.

The GSW had a 65mm lens on it and was the 'wide angle' version (this was also replicated with the 670 models).

I had the GSW version which was great, light weight, sync at any flash speed and for a camera of its size very quiet.

Very early versions of the 690 was the GL690 which dates from the early 70's ? this carried the nickname of the 'Texas Leica' and had three interechangble lens. These are rarer but seem to fetch a fair old price.
